How to Pair Beats to iPhone: A Step-by-Step Guide for Easy Setup

January 21, 2026 By Matthew Burleigh

how to pair beats to iphone

Pairing your Beats headphones to an iPhone is a piece of cake. First, make sure your Beats are charged and turned on. Next, open your iPhone’s Bluetooth settings and look for your Beats on the list. Tap on them to connect. Once paired, you’ll be ready to enjoy your music wirelessly. This quick process will have you set up in just a few moments!

Step-by-Step Tutorial for Pairing Beats to iPhone

To pair your Beats with your iPhone, follow these simple steps. It’s an easy process that will connect your devices for seamless listening.

Step 1: Turn On Your Beats

Make sure your Beats are powered on.

Hold the power button until you see the LED light. This indicates that your Beats are ready to connect.

Step 2: Open Bluetooth Settings on iPhone

Navigate to Settings > Bluetooth on your iPhone.

Ensure that Bluetooth is turned on. If it’s off, toggle it so it’s active, allowing your phone to search for nearby devices.

Step 3: Put Beats in Pairing Mode

Press and hold the power button on your Beats until the light flashes.

This flashing light shows your Beats are discoverable and ready to pair with your iPhone.

Step 4: Select Your Beats from the List

Look for your Beats in the list of available devices on your iPhone.

Once you spot them, tap to connect. Your iPhone will take a moment to establish the connection.

Step 5: Confirm the Connection

A notification will appear to confirm a successful connection.

Once connected, you’ll see your Beats listed as "Connected" on the Bluetooth settings screen.

After completing these steps, your Beats will be paired with your iPhone. You’ll hear a confirmation sound in your headphones, and you can start playing your favorite tunes wirelessly!

Tips for Pairing Beats to iPhone

  • Charge your Beats: Ensure they have enough power to connect and be used without interruption.
  • Keep devices close: For optimal pairing, keep your Beats and iPhone close together during the process.
  • Update your iPhone: Running the latest iOS can improve connectivity and device recognition.
  • Reset Bluetooth: If you’re having issues, turning Bluetooth off and on again can refresh the connection.
  • Check compatibility: Some older Beats models may require specific steps for pairing, so check your manual if unsure.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why won’t my Beats connect to my iPhone?

Make sure both devices are charged and Bluetooth is enabled on your iPhone. Restart both if needed.

Do I need an app to pair my Beats to my iPhone?

No, you can pair them directly through the iPhone’s Bluetooth settings without an app.

Can I pair multiple Beats to the same iPhone?

You can pair multiple Beats, but only one device can play audio at a time.

How do I disconnect my Beats from my iPhone?

In the Bluetooth settings, find your Beats and tap "Forget This Device" to disconnect them.

Will my Beats automatically connect to my iPhone next time?

Yes, once paired, they should automatically connect when turned on and in range.
